II. Task 2
Write an essay describing the city life.
Give reasons for your answer and include any relevant examples from your own
knowledge or experience. You should write about 250 words.
The city is a densely populated location where many people live and work. In a
large city, life moves at a breakneck speed. At different times of the day, city life is
bustling with activity.
Life in a city begins early in the morning. The sun revealing itself from the horizon
allows its warm rays to land on the blue wall mirrors of the buildings standing tall
on both sides of the immense road in front of me. People rush for work and daily
activities. The streets are noisy with traffic and the honking of car horns during rush
hours. Children and office workers rush to school and work. Stores have begun to
open to prepare for the new day. Breakfast stalls look delicious and give off an
attractive aroma. With each passing hour, the traffic continues to grow. The
atmosphere in the morning was hustle and bustle.
The afternoon in the city is somewhat less noisy. Everyone was settled at work. The
road became sparsely trafficked, with a few hawker cars scattered about. Elderly
adults jog and exercise on the sidewalk or by the lake.
When the sun goes down, the city becomes more bustling and lively when the street
lights are on. Every stream of people poured into the street one by one. Different
from going to work in the morning, now they dress up beautifully, with colorful
clothes of all kinds... Under the lights, under the colors of clothes, the whole city
seems to stand out against the dark sky. The entertainment and dining area becomes
more vibrant than ever. On the sidewalk, people crowded around in groups, arm in
arm, they chatted happily, sometimes bursting into giggles. The city at night,
everyone seems to forget all the fatigue after a working day.
Life is faster and busier in cities. A city expands an individual's horizons with
countless activities during the day. The hustle and bustle of the city is also a good
opportunity for people to experience more, grow and succeed.
